/*****************************************************************************
*
*   ObjMgr manipulates the "registry" of Objects in memory
*       assigns "EntityID" to Objects loaded in memory..
*   		only top level Object gets an EntityID
*   		caching and locking also done on top level Object
*
*   WARNING: This system currently only supports the predefined types here.
*       new types can be added with some limited recoding, but cannot be
*          added on the fly until additional work is done.
*
*****************************************************************************/

/*****************************************************************************
*
*   ObjMgrReadLock()
*   	Initialize if not done already
*       A thread can have only one read or write lock at a time
*       Many threads can have read locks
*       Only one thread can have a write lock
*       No other threads may have read locks if a write lock is granted
*       If another thread holds a write lock, this call blocks until write
*          is unlocked.
*
*****************************************************************************/
NLM_EXTERN ObjMgrPtr LIBCALL ObjMgrReadLock PROTO((void));

/*****************************************************************************
*
*   ObjMgrWriteLock()
*   	Initialize if not done already
*       A thread can have only one read or write lock at a time
*       Many threads can have read locks
*       Only one thread can have a write lock
*       No other threads may have read locks if a write lock is granted
*       If another thread holds a read or write lock, this call blocks until write
*          is unlocked.
*
*****************************************************************************/
NLM_EXTERN ObjMgrPtr LIBCALL ObjMgrWriteLock PROTO((void));

/*****************************************************************************
*
*   ObjMgrSetHold()
*     Increments hold count in ObjMgr
*       returns current hold count
*     if hold != 0, then no tempload records are cached out of memory
*     This is useful if you are doing a complex task involving repeated
*      access to many records and you want them to stay in memory while
*      the task is performed, even though they are loaded temporarily by
*      BioseqLock..
*     Be sure to call ObjMgrClearHold() when you are done so they can be
*      cached out.
*
*****************************************************************************/
NLM_EXTERN Uint2 LIBCALL ObjMgrSetHold PROTO((void));

/*****************************************************************************
*
*   ObjMgrGetEntityIDForPointer(data)
*   	returns the EntityID for any pointer, Choice or Data
*       This function will move up to the top of the tree it may be
*          in. If top level EntityID is 0, one is assigned at this point.
*       If an element is moved under a different hierarchy, its EntityID will
*          change.
*
*       Either ObjMgrGetEntityIDForPointer() or ObjMgrGetEntityIDForChoice()
*   		MUST be called to have an OM_MSG_CREATE message sent to any
*           registered proceedures
*   
*       returns 0 on failure.
*
*****************************************************************************/
NLM_EXTERN Uint2 LIBCALL ObjMgrGetEntityIDForPointer PROTO((Pointer ptr));
